Understanding Different Types of Tap Mechanisms
Modern homes feature various tap designs, each requiring different repair approaches. Traditional pillar taps use rubber washers that press against valve seats to stop water flow. When these washers deteriorate, water seeps through, creating the familiar dripping sound. Mixer taps, increasingly popular in Banstead kitchens and bathrooms, combine hot and cold water through ceramic disc cartridges or ball valves. These mechanisms are more complex but often more durable than traditional washers. Ceramic disc taps represent the latest technology, using precisely manufactured ceramic plates that slide against each other to control water flow. These taps rarely develop the gradual leaks associated with washer-based systems but can fail suddenly when ceramic components crack or when debris interferes with the disc alignment. Ball valve taps, common in older mixer installations, use a perforated metal ball that rotates to align holes with inlet ports, controlled by cam assemblies and springs.Identifying Your Tap Type
Before attempting repairs, determine which mechanism your tap uses. Traditional taps have separate hot and cold handles that turn multiple times to fully open or close. Mixer taps typically feature either a single lever that moves up and down plus side to side, or two handles that turn less than a quarter rotation from off to full flow. Single-lever taps usually contain cartridge mechanisms, whilst quarter-turn taps often use ceramic discs or ball valves.Common Failure Points
Each tap type has characteristic weak points where leaks develop. Traditional taps fail when washers harden and crack or when valve seats become scored and uneven. O-rings around the spindle frequently perish, causing leaks around the handle base. Mixer taps develop problems when cartridge seals deteriorate or when ceramic discs become damaged by debris in the water supply. Banstead's hard water, typical throughout Surrey, accelerates limescale buildup that can interfere with these precision components.Essential Tools and Materials for Tap Repairs
Successful tap repair requires appropriate tools and replacement parts. Basic requirements include adjustable spanners, screwdrivers, needle-nose pliers, and a torch for examining components in confined spaces. More complex repairs might need specific tools like seat dressing tools for smoothing damaged valve seats or cartridge removal tools for stubborn mixer tap mechanisms. Replacement parts vary by tap type and manufacturer. Traditional taps need washers in various sizes, typically ranging from 12mm to 20mm diameter. O-rings come in multiple dimensions, so removing the old ring before purchasing replacements ensures proper fitment. Mixer tap cartridges are manufacturer-specific, making identification crucial before sourcing parts. Photography of removed components helps match replacements accurately when visiting plumbing suppliers.Preparing Your Workspace
Clear the area around the tap and place towels to catch water and protect surfaces. Locate the water supply isolation valves, typically found under kitchen sinks or near bathroom fixtures. If individual isolation valves aren't present, you'll need to turn off the mains water supply. In Banstead properties, stop taps are usually located where the supply pipe enters the building, often in utility areas or under kitchen sinks.Safety Considerations
Always isolate electrical supplies before working near mixer taps with built-in electrical components or when working in wet conditions. Ensure adequate lighting and ventilation, particularly when using chemical descaling products. Keep replacement parts organised and label removed components to facilitate reassembly. Take photographs before dismantling complex mechanisms to reference during rebuilding.Step-by-Step Repair Process for Traditional Taps
Begin by turning off the water supply and opening the tap fully to drain remaining water from the pipes. Remove the tap handle, which may be secured by a screw under a decorative cap or by friction fit depending on the design. Use gentle heat from a hair dryer if the handle is stuck due to limescale buildup, common in Banstead's hard water area. Once the handle is removed, use an adjustable spanner to unscrew the headgear nut, turning anticlockwise. The entire internal mechanism should lift out, exposing the rubber washer at the bottom of the spindle. This washer is usually secured by a small screw or pressed onto a threaded post. Remove the old washer and examine the valve seat for scoring or damage. Clean all components thoroughly, removing limescale deposits with appropriate descaling products. Replace the washer with an exact size match, ensuring the new component sits flat against the valve seat. If the valve seat appears damaged, use a seat dressing tool to resurface it or consider professional repair. Reassemble components in reverse order, ensuring all threads engage properly without overtightening. Test the repair by slowly restoring water supply and checking for leaks. Minor weeping often stops once new washers bed in, but persistent leaks indicate incomplete seating or continued valve seat problems requiring further attention.Repairing Modern Mixer Taps
Mixer tap repairs typically involve replacing entire cartridge assemblies rather than individual components. Start by identifying the cartridge type through manufacturer markings or by carefully removing the existing unit for matching. Turn off both hot and cold supplies, then remove the tap handle and any decorative shrouds concealing the cartridge housing. Cartridge removal methods vary significantly between manufacturers. Some require special tools, whilst others unscrew with standard spanners. Stubborn cartridges may need penetrating oil and gentle persuasion with appropriate tools. Avoid excessive force that could damage the tap body or surrounding pipework.Dealing with Limescale and Debris
Surrey's hard water creates substantial limescale buildup in tap mechanisms. Before installing replacement cartridges, clean the housing thoroughly with appropriate descaling products. Check that new cartridges orient correctly, as incorrect installation can reverse hot and cold supplies or prevent proper operation. Some cartridges have alignment features or markings indicating correct positioning.Ceramic Disc Tap Repairs
Ceramic disc mechanisms rarely need complete replacement unless ceramic components crack. More commonly, O-rings and seals around the cartridge housing deteriorate, causing external leaks. These seals can often be replaced without changing the entire cartridge, making repairs more economical. Clean ceramic surfaces carefully to remove debris that might prevent proper sealing between disc surfaces.Troubleshooting Persistent Leaks
If leaks persist after component replacement, several factors might be responsible. Incorrect washer or cartridge sizing allows water to bypass sealing surfaces. Damaged valve seats in traditional taps prevent washers from sealing effectively, requiring professional resurfacing or tap replacement. Overtightened connections can distort sealing surfaces or crack components, particularly in older installations. Water pressure fluctuations, common in elevated areas of Banstead, can exacerbate minor sealing problems that might be acceptable under steady pressure conditions. Check that replacement parts match original specifications exactly, as even minor dimensional differences can prevent effective sealing. Cross-threading during reassembly damages threads and prevents proper tightening, whilst undertightening allows movement that breaks seals. Use appropriate thread sealant on metal threads whilst avoiding contamination of sealing surfaces. Some modern cartridges include integral sealing that requires no additional compounds. Temperature cycling from hot water use can accelerate seal deterioration, particularly if replacement components are of lower quality than original parts. Investment in quality replacement parts often proves economical long-term, reducing the frequency of repeat repairs.When to Call a Professional
Whilst many tap repairs are within DIY capabilities, certain situations require professional intervention. If isolation valves cannot be closed or are themselves leaking, attempting repairs risks flooding and water damage. Corroded or damaged pipework behind taps needs professional assessment to determine repair feasibility and compliance with current regulations. Mixer taps with built-in electrical components for temperature display or automatic operation require qualified attention to ensure safety and warranty compliance. Similarly, taps integrated with water filtration systems or pressure booster pumps involve complex mechanisms beyond typical DIY repair scope. Repeated failures after component replacement suggest underlying problems like excessive water pressure, poor installation, or compatibility issues between new parts and existing fixtures. Professional diagnosis can identify these systemic problems and provide lasting solutions rather than temporary fixes. Historic properties in Banstead sometimes feature unusual tap mechanisms or non-standard threading that requires specialist knowledge and parts sourcing. Professional plumbers familiar with period fixtures can often restore these units effectively whilst maintaining their character and functionality.Frequently Asked Questions
How long should tap repairs take to complete?
Simple washer replacement typically takes 30-45 minutes including preparation and testing. Mixer tap cartridge replacement usually requires 45-60 minutes depending on accessibility and cartridge type. Complex repairs involving valve seat restoration or multiple component replacement can take 90 minutes or more. Professional repairs often proceed faster due to experience and appropriate tools, though initial diagnosis time should be factored into scheduling.Why do my taps keep developing leaks despite recent repairs?
Recurring leaks often indicate underlying issues beyond worn washers or seals. Damaged valve seats prevent effective sealing regardless of new washers, whilst excessive water pressure can overwhelm sealing capabilities. Poor quality replacement parts may deteriorate rapidly, particularly in hard water areas like Banstead. Incorrect sizing or installation of replacement components also causes premature failure. Professional assessment can identify root causes and provide lasting solutions.Can I repair taps myself without any plumbing experience?
Basic tap repairs like washer replacement are achievable for most homeowners with appropriate guidance and patience. However, success depends on having correct tools, quality replacement parts, and ability to follow instructions carefully. Complex mixer taps or situations involving damaged pipework require professional expertise. Start with simple repairs and don't hesitate to seek professional help if problems seem beyond your capabilities or if initial attempts are unsuccessful.What causes taps to leak more frequently during winter months?
Temperature fluctuations during winter cause expansion and contraction of metal components, which can loosen connections or stress seals. Increased heating use often means more hot water draws through taps, accelerating wear on components exposed to temperature cycling. Reduced water usage during holiday periods can allow sediment to settle in mechanisms, interfering with sealing. Additionally, temporary increases in water pressure during peak usage periods can expose marginal seals that cope adequately under normal conditions.How do I know if my tap needs complete replacement rather than repair?
Consider replacement when repair costs approach 60-70% of new tap price, particularly for older units with multiple worn components. Cracked tap bodies, severely damaged threads, or corroded internal mechanisms often make repair impractical. Repeated failures after professional repair suggest fundamental problems that replacement addresses more effectively.
